Output ec75cedf256da6a84c9b36376c7cbe76f1f413d6850f08451fe8453207f45224:9

value
133909
script pubkey
OP_0 OP_PUSHBYTES_20 c89ff1bd0028e9909d0145b783eb0d0779f8479c
address
bc1qez0lr0gq9r5ep8gpgkmc86cdqauls3uul7xgw4
transaction
ec75cedf256da6a84c9b36376c7cbe76f1f413d6850f08451fe8453207f45224